Within the past hour, the power at the Muscogee County Jail went out and has been restored. During the outage, multiple additional MCSO patrol units, personnel, and supervisors were dispatched and responded to the facility. We would like to thank all MCSO employees for their quick response and professionalism during this time. Multiple headcounts were conducted, and all inmates were accounted for at all times. The backup generators are tested monthly by the CCG Facilities Maintenance team; however, the backup generators failed for unknown reasons. CCG Facilities Maintenance is on-site, and we thank them for their swift response as well.

🚨JAIL CHANGES: The Fulton County Jail will stop accepting most people arrested on misdemeanor charges starting July 1.

Sheriff Patrick Labat announced exceptions will only be made for domestic violence, sexual assault, or aggravated circumstances.

The policy change follows a formal legal opinion requested to address severe jail overcrowding and worsening facility conditions.
